Début du domaine contenu

Documentation fonction Affichage du statut Localiser le document dans l'arbre de navigation

Utilisation

Cette fonction sert à vérifier le statut d'un processus.

Fonctionnalités

Dans l'atelier de processus HR, le système R/3 affiche le statut actuel de chaque processus.

Vous pouvez également afficher le statut des matricules traités dans un processus.

Statut du processus

Le statut du processus est affiché aux niveaux du processus, de l'étape du processus, de l'exécution et du lot. Les icônes affectées à ces niveaux au cours de l'exécution du processus, ou après, fournissent des informations sur le statut du processus. Pour afficher la légende de ces icônes, voir Utilitaires.

Le statut du processus peut être défini comme suit :

·        Correctement terminé

Vous pouvez à présent clôturer le processus.

·        Provisoire

Ce statut n'est pas utilisé actuellement.

·        Terminé avec erreur

Pour analyser le problème, affichez la liste spool (voir Contrôle de processus). Supprimez l'erreur, puis répétez l'étape du processus.

·        Planifié

Vous avez planifié l'exécution du processus de manière qu'elle ait lieu avant ou après qu'un événement se soit produit dans le système R/3.

·        En cours d'exécution

L'atelier de processus HR exécute actuellement le processus.

·        Annulé

Pour analyser le problème, affichez le protocole de job (voir Contrôle de processus). Supprimez l'erreur, puis répétez l'étape du processus.

·        Point d'arrêt

L'atelier de processus HR a interrompu le processus à un point d'arrêt conditionnel ou inconditionnel. Pour continuer le processus, lancez l'étape du processus immédiatement après le point d'arrêt.

·        Attente

Vous avez planifié le processus pour qu'il s'exécute lors d'un événement dans le système R/3. Le processus attend le déclenchement de cet événement.

Statut de matricules

Au cours de l'exécution du processus, chaque matricule reçoit des informations relatives au statut de traitement. Ainsi, vous pouvez suivre le statut d'un matricule tout au long du processus. Seuls les matricules traités correctement sont transférés d'une étape du processus vers la suivante.

Vous pouvez afficher le statut d'un matricule à tous les niveaux de processus. Le statut peut être défini comme suit :

·        Correctement terminé

·        Provisoire

Ce statut est attribué aux matricules traités à l'aide de données incomplètes, mais correctement, par l'étape du processus. Les matricules dotés de ce statut sont transférés vers l'étape du processus suivante, où ils peuvent être traités. Leur statut est défini sur Provisoire dans toutes les étapes du processus suivantes.

·        Erroné

Si le programme a identifié des erreurs, ce statut est affecté aux matricules.

Exemple

Par exemple, ce statut est affecté aux matricules lorsque le programme de paie est en cours d'exécution si le système R/3 les sauvegarde dans le Lien structurematchcode W (Traitement de correction : paie).

·        Initial

Ce statut est affecté aux matricules s'étant avérés erronés au cours d'une étape du processus précédente et ne pouvant par conséquent pas être traités par l'étape actuelle. Contrôlez alors l'erreur survenue lors de l'étape précédente, corrigez‑la, puis exécutez à nouveau cette étape.

·        Non sélectionné

Les matricules avec ce statut ne sont pas transférés vers l'étape du processus suivante.

Note

Vous pouvez utiliser ce statut pour poursuivre le traitement des matricules séparément les uns des autres, à partir d'une étape spécifique.

Exemple

La paie doit être exécutée pour tous les matricules à la fois. Toutefois, vous souhaitez lancer des exploitations différentes pour les matricules affectés à la société 0001 et pour ceux affectés à la société 0002.

Procédez comme suit :

·         Créez un programme, puis insérez la zone Société dans l'écran de sélection. Toutefois, la zone ne doit pas accéder à la base de données logique ni influer sur la sélection de programme.

·         Créez deux variantes pour ce programme :

·         Dans la variante 1, la valeur de la zone Société est 0001.

·         Dans la variante 2, la valeur de la zone Société est 0002.

·         Insérez deux étapes du processus parallèles après l'étape du processus Paie de votre modèle de processus. Attribuez la variante 1 du programme à l'une des étapes du processus et la variante 2 à l'autre étape.

·         Insérez les exploitationsnécessaires en tant qu'étapes ultérieures de ces deux étapes du processus.

Si vous lancez un processus reposant sur ce modèle de processus, le système R/3 paramètre tous les matricules n'appartenant pas à la société 0001 sur le statut Non sélectionné lors de l'exécution de l'étape du processus avec la variante 1. Par conséquent, ces matricules ne sont pas transférés vers les étapes du processus suivantes. L'exécution de l'étape du processus avec la variante 2 a l'effet opposé.

Activités

Pour afficher le statut d'un niveau de processus spécifique, développez tous les niveaux.

Pour afficher les matricules dotés d'un statut spécifique, sélectionnez le niveau de processus approprié, puis Saut ®Afficher les matricules et enfin le statut requis.

 

 

Fin du domaine contenu